Significance of Roof Drainage
Roof drainage is crucial for a number of reasons:
Preventing Water Accumulation: Standing water can lead to leaks, structural damage, and possible mold development.
Enhancing Building Longevity: Proper drainage assists mitigate wear and tear on roofing products, therefore extending the roof's life.
Keeping Aesthetic Appeal: A properly designed drainage system contributes to the general look of the structure, preventing undesirable water accumulation.
Mitigating Ice Dams: In colder climates, efficient roof drainage can help avoid the formation of ice dams, which can hurt gutters and roofing materials.
Environmental Responsibility: Efficient water management through roof drainage can lower overflow and decrease the environmental effect.
Types of Roof Drainage Systems
Numerous methods can be employed to make sure reliable roof drainage. The most typical types include:
1. Gravity Drainage
This technique utilizes gravity to direct water away from the roof surface area.
Internal Drains: Located within the structure's structure, these drains pipes usage piping systems to get rid of water straight to the ground or the structure's drainage system.
Roof Drainage Leaders: These are vertical pipelines used to carry rainwater from the roof to the ground.
2. Slope Drainage
Producing slopes in the roof structure guarantees water flows towards designated drainage points.
Favorable Drainage: A pitch or slope directs water to particular drains or ambushes.
Enhanced Slope Systems: These frequently feature structured designs to improve water circulation efficiency.
3. Gutter Systems
Gutters collect water that runs the roof edges, directing it securely away.
K-Style Gutters: Popularly used due to their aesthetic and practical advantages.
Half-Round Gutters: Known for their timeless look and efficient water flow.
4. Trough Drainage
This method incorporates large, shallow channels designed to obstruct water before it collects.
Trench Drains: Ideal for large flat roofs, these systems often include grates to keep particles out while carrying water.
Capture Basins: Positioned strategically to gather rainwater and filter out debris.

To make sure the longevity and efficiency of roof drainage systems, consider the following best practices:
Regular Inspection: Conduct regular examinations to identify debris build-up, clogs, or structural damage.
Maintain Clear Drains and Gutters: Promptly get rid of leaves, dirt, and other obstructions to ensure water streams easily.
Set Up Properly Sized Systems: Roof drainage systems must be sufficiently sized for the structure's needs and local rainfall patterns.
Think About Local Weather Conditions: Design drainage systems considering the local environment to prevent flooding and other drainage concerns.
Utilize Professional Services: Hiring experienced professionals for installation and maintenance can considerably improve performance.
Frequently Asked Questions About Roof DrainageQ1: What are the indications of inefficient roof drainage?
Indications of ineffective roof drainage consist of leakages, water stains on ceilings, mold development, and sagging ceilings or walls.
Q2: How often should roof drainage systems be examined?
It is suggested to examine roof drainage systems at least two times a year, ideally in spring and fall, and after significant storms.
Q3: Can I install a roof drainage system myself?
While small maintenance jobs can be carried out by property owners, it is best to hire professionals for installation to guarantee it fulfills local structure codes and functions properly.
Q4: What should I do if I discover obstructions in my roof drainage system?
If clogs are discovered, they must be cleared immediately. If the clog is not quickly accessible or manageable, it may be best to seek advice from a professional.
Q5: Are green roofings effective for drainage?
Yes, green roofs can be really effective for drainage as they take in rainwater, lowering runoff while supplying insulation and aesthetic benefits to buildings.
